@onderwijsin/nuxt-sentry-config
Configure Sentry server monitoring once and switch between Node and Cloudflare Nitro runtimes without rewriting the initialization options.

});The module defaults to node-server. When nitro.preset or NITRO_PRESET is cloudflare_module,
it automatically uses Sentry's Cloudflare Nitro plugin instead. You can explicitly set
sentryConfig.runtime when runtime selection is managed outside those values.
sentryConfig does not replace the sentry option from @sentry/nuxt/module. Configure that
option separately for build-time concerns such as organisation, project, authentication, and
source-map uploads. The sentryConfig option only controls this module's runtime-portable server
initialization.

}));The file is imported into the server build instead of serialized through Nuxt runtime config. This preserves the complete Sentry option surface, including functions, integrations, transports, and event hooks. Keep the object to options supported by both runtimes when the deployment should be interchangeable; runtime-specific Sentry options remain available when needed.
Resolver functions receive { runtime, runtimeConfig } when Sentry starts. runtime is either
"node-server" or "cloudflare_module"; runtimeConfig is Nitro's resolved runtime config with
matching NUXT_* environment variables applied at startup. For example,
NUXT_PUBLIC_SENTRY_DSN=https://… overrides runtimeConfig.public.sentry.dsn without rebuilding
the application. This lets one build and config file select guarded, runtime-specific options while
still accepting deployment-specific values.
The module writes runtimeConfig.public.sentry.dsn and runtimeConfig.public.sentry.runtime for
consumer-owned client and server config files. The DSN is public by design; never put the Sentry
auth token in runtime config.

Diagnostic test tools
By default, the module provides a small diagnostic page at /_sentry and a deliberate-error
endpoint at /api/_sentry/trigger-error. The page sends a client exception, starts a frontend
trace, and calls the server endpoint. It also displays the active Node or Cloudflare runtime. Use it
only in an environment where controlled errors are acceptable; the endpoint intentionally creates a
Sentry event.
The endpoint has a per-IP limit of five requests per minute through
@onderwijsin/nuxt-simple-rate-limiter. This is best-effort abuse control, not an authentication or
security boundary. Restrict access at your proxy or deployment platform when the route is available
outside a test environment.

Node runtime
For Node, the module emits .output/server/sentry.server.config.mjs. It initializes Sentry before
the Nitro server begins handling requests. Choose exactly one startup strategy; using two
initializes Sentry twice and can produce duplicate instrumentation and difficult-to-diagnose errors.
Plug-and-play startup (default)
autoInjectServerConfig defaults to true. At build time the module places an import of the
emitted preload at the top of .output/server/index.mjs, so the ordinary Nitro command is
sufficient:
node .output/server/index.mjsUse this option when the deployment platform controls the Node command or when the simplest
deployment path is preferred. Do not additionally pass Node's --import flag.

NODE_OPTIONS="--import ./.output/server/sentry.server.config.mjs" node .output/server/index.mjsThe preload file is emitted in both modes; the option only decides whether the module injects it
into Nitro's entrypoint. Do not also enable @sentry/nuxt's sentry.autoInjectServerSentry,
because this module is already responsible for server initialization.

});Source-map upload guard
@sentry/nuxt can register Sentry upload plugins for both Vite and the final Nitro Rollup build.
The extra Nitro pass can duplicate artifact work and significantly increase build memory, so this
module removes the sentry-rollup-plugin pass by default. Set disableNitroSourceMapUpload: false
to retain the upstream Nitro upload plugin.
Options
| Option | Default | Purpose |
| ----------------------------- | ---------------------------- | --------------------------------------------------------------- |
| enabled | true | Enables all module wiring. |
| dsn | omitted | Public Sentry DSN exposed as runtimeConfig.public.sentry.dsn. |
| runtime | inferred | Overrides node-server or cloudflare_module detection. |
| configFile | omitted | Consumer config file, resolved from the Nuxt root. |
| autoInjectServerConfig | true | Adds the generated Node preload to Nitro's entry. |
| disableNitroSourceMapUpload | true | Removes the duplicate Nitro Sentry upload pass. |
| testTools | enabled | Optional diagnostic page and controlled-error endpoint. |
| testTools.page | /_sentry | Browser diagnostic page; set to false to omit it. |
| testTools.endpoint | /api/_sentry/trigger-error | Rate-limited deliberate-error route; set to false to omit it. |
Compatibility
Developed and tested against Nuxt 4.5.x, Nitro 2.13.x, and Sentry 10.69.x. The package requires Node.js 24 or newer for builds and Node deployments. Node.js 22 may work but is untested and unsupported.
